Management’s Discussion & Analysis - Results of Operations
Non-Interest Income. page 20
Proposed changes to future 10-K and 10-Q filings:
Through the first nine months of 2007, impairment losses of $1.7 million were recorded on a strategic investment made over time in another bank holding company. Over the past eighteen months the market value of bank stocks in general, and this investment specifically, have declined. In Management’s opinion these industry and company trends may continue for an undetermined period of time, resulting in “other than temporary” impairment.
